Mercian in American English
a person born or living in Mercia
of Mercia or its people or dialect
adjective: of or pertaining to Mercia, its inhabitants, or their dialect
noun: a native or inhabitant of Mercia

Mercian in British English
adjective: of or relating to Mercia or the dialect spoken there
noun: the dialect of Old and Middle English spoken in the Midlands of England south of the River Humber
